What affects the price

The final price for your bathroom project depends on a few specific things. First, the size of your space and the layout changes you want matter. If we are moving plumbing lines or electrical outlets, that adds labor time compared to a simple swap. Your choice of materials—like tile type, custom vanities, or premium shower hardware—also shifts the total. We focus on your specific needs to ensure you don't overpay for things you don't want. What are common bathroom sconces used?

Common bathroom sconces are wall-mounted light fixtures that provide task lighting. They are often installed on either side of a mirror. Styles range from modern to traditional. Consider the brightness and spread of light needed for your space.
